AceShowbiz - Avan Jogia broke his silence on the "Aladdin" rumor after he was rumored to be circling the lead role. The "Victorious" alum was reportedly considered for the role after he sent in an audition tape where he sang a song from the classic animated film.
Director Guy Ritchie remained silent on the buzzing rumor, but the actor responded in a tweet. "Though I am flattered by all the support, there is something to be said about not believing everything you can read," so the former Nickelodeon star wrote.

Rumor has it, Disney is eying someone of Middle-Eastern or Indian descent for the male lead. Dutch actor Achraf Koutet, Canadian actor Mena Massoud and American George Kosturos are among the rumored candidates. Naomi Scott ("Power Rangers") and Indian actress Tara Sutaria are eyed for the role of Jasmine while Will Smith is expected to play Genie.
